Job description

Job Summary:
IBM Software is dedicated to transforming client challenges into innovative solutions through AI-powered, cloud-native products. They are seeking a Senior Backend Engineer to build reliable and scalable backend systems, lead complex initiatives, and collaborate with cross-functional teams to deliver impactful solutions.
Responsibilities:
• Design, build, and ship backend systems—from early design and prototyping through production rollout—while maintaining a strong focus on stability, performance, and usability
• Own large, cross‑functional initiatives, leading technical execution and ensuring reliable delivery from concept through implementation and ongoing support
• Serve as a technical subject‑matter expert, with a strong emphasis on Golang development, quality engineering, and backend best practices
• Drive end‑to‑end project execution, including architecture design, implementation, debugging, and issue resolution, with an eye toward long‑term maintainability
• Evaluate tradeoffs and make sound technical decisions, proactively identifying risks, removing blockers, and keeping stakeholders aligned on progress and milestones
• Collaborate closely with Product, Design, and Engineering partners to design solutions that meet both technical requirements and real customer needs
• Influence and advocate for technical roadmap initiatives that improve system reliability, scalability, and developer experience across teams
• Debug and resolve complex production issues, improving the overall quality, resilience, and observability of our systems
• Review code with a critical eye toward quality, design patterns, performance, and scalability, helping set and uphold engineering standards
• Mentor and support other engineers, sharing knowledge, encouraging best practices, and fostering a culture of technical excellence
• Promote strong collaboration through pair programming, design discussions, and team troubleshooting sessions
• Help support a reliable production environment, including participation in an on‑call rotation
• Champion clean, maintainable code and comprehensive testing throughout the development lifecycle
Qualifications:
Required:
• You have at least 6+ years of experience as an engineer, developing with modern programming languages and frameworks, and are interested in working in Golang specifically.
• Emerging ability to direct work and influence others, with a strategic approach to problem-solving and decision-making in a collaborative environment. Be able to demonstrate business acumen and customer focus, with a readiness for change and adaptability in dynamic situations.
• You have experience working with distributed systems, particularly cloud providers such as AWS, Azure or GCP, with a focus on scalability, resilience, security and familiarity with cloud monitoring tools for high reliability and performance.
• Intentional focus on stakeholder management and effective communication, fostering trust and relationship-building across diverse teams.
• Integrated skills in critical thinking and data-driven analysis, promoting a growth mindset and continuous improvement to support high-quality outcomes.
Preferred:
• You have experience using HashiCorp products (Terraform, Packer, Waypoint, Nomad, Vault, Boundary, Consul).
• You have prior experience working in cloud platform engineering teams.

IBM provides technology and consulting, including software, infrastructure systems, and cloud-based solutions. Founded in 1911, the company is headquartered in Armonk, USA, with a team of 10001+ employees. The company is currently Late Stage.
